Consumers Expected to Favor Cyber Monday Over Black Friday

| Daniela Forte

Consumers of all ages are more likely to shop on Cyber Monday than Black Friday, according to a Deloitte survey, spending 59% of their holiday budget online, compared with just 36% in store as ecommerce takes a bigger bite. Here is what Deloitte predicts for holiday 2019.

Prime Day by the Numbers: 175 Million Items Ordered and Other Cool Stats

| Mike O'Brien

Prime Day saw 175 million items purchased by Prime members over the two days, according to Amazon, eclipsing its 2018 Black Friday and Cyber Monday sales combined, while analysts pegged total GMV at $6 billion to $6.2 billion. Wayfair Launches Way Day Shopping Event

| Daniela Forte

Wayfair is taking on Amazon and Alibaba with its own one-day shopping event called Way Day, promising Black Friday-like deals on home furnishings, décor and home improvement items on April 25.
